Various examples relate to systems and methods for controlling autonomous vehicles including towing vehicles and trailers. For example, the system may determine that a line from a location of a first sensor on the autonomous vehicle to a location of a first actor in an environment of the autonomous vehicle intersects the trailer. The system may determine that the first actor is in a blind spot of the autonomous vehicle, generate a motion plan for the autonomous vehicle, and control the autonomous vehicle according to the motion plan.
